Indonesia may extend safeguard measures on imports of curtains, related textiles

( December 2, 2025, 04:30 GMT | Official Statement) -- Mlex Summary: Indonesia’s Trade Safeguards Committee, or KPPI, said Monday that it began an investigation on Nov. 25 into whether to extend safeguard measures on imports of curtains and related household textile products. The investigation follows a request filed by the Indonesian Textile Association, or API, which said domestic producers are still facing “serious losses or the threat of serious losses.” Imports are dominated by China, accounting for 71.23 percent of the total, followed by India with 7.12 percent and Brazil with 6.25 percent.Statement follows (in Indonesian).Komite Pengamanan Perdagangan Indonesia (KPPI) memulai penyelidikan perpanjangan tindakan pengamanan perdagangan/TPP (safeguard measures) terhadap impor tirai pada Selasa (25/11).
